Programs and Services
Youth and Family Services includes the following programs and service areas:
- Mountain Mentors: A community-based mentoring program that matches caring adult volunteers with youth ages 8 to 16.
- Communities that Care : A community-wide coalition that promotes healthy lifestyles.
- Child Care Licensing: Anyone who cares for unrelated children on a regular basis must obtain a child care license.
- Family & Parenting Support Programs, such as Strengthening Families Outreach Program and Summit County Community Play Group, offer support, networking and education for parents and their children. Parenting Class Information
- School Based & After School Programs: We offer a number of school-based and after-school programs that teach life skills and encourage healthy lifestyles, including Healthy Choices, Reconnecting Youth and Teen Drop-In "The Drop".
